Alarms Menu

Example for Setting an Alarm

The following shows how to set Alarm 1 to activate if the mass flow rate is greater than 100 lb/hr. You can check the alarm configuration in the Run Mode by pressing the ￿￿ keys until Alarm [1] appears. The lower line displays the mass flow rate at which the alarm activates. Note: all outputs are disabled while using the Setup Menus.

First, set the desired units of measurement:

1.Use ￿￿ keys to move to the Units Menu (see to page 3-9).

2.Press ￿ key until Mass Flow Unit appears. Press ENTER.

3.Press ￿ key until lb appears in the numerator. Press ￿ key to move the underline cursor to the denominator. Press the ￿ key until hr appears in the denominator. Press ENTER to select.

4.Press ￿ key until Units Menu appears.

Second, set the alarm:

1.Use ￿￿ keys to move to the Alarms Menu.

2.Press the ￿ key until Alarm Output 1 appears.

3.Press ￿ key to access Measure selections. Press ENTER and use the ￿ key to select Mass. Press ENTER.

4.Press ￿ key to select the alarm Mode. Press ENTER and use ￿ key to select HIGH Alarm. Press ENTER.

5.Press ￿ key to select the value that must be exceeded before the alarm activates. Press ENTER and use

￿￿￿￿ keys to set 100 or 100.0. Press ENTER.

6.Press the EXIT key to save your changes. (Alarm changes are always permanently saved.) (Up to three alarm outputs are available depending on meter configuration.)
